With the use of the Qualigen FastPack* blood-testing analyzer, men who participate in this
GW program will get the results of their blood work and their exam as they leave the appointment.
This is the first blood testing analyzer custom-designed to perform
complex quantitative immunoassay tests. No need to take time off work, come during your lunch

While some coaches are thinking about the “Big Dance” in March, GW Colonials Basketball
Head Coach Karl Hobbs is “getting in the game” this September to encourage men in
the District to get tested for Prostate Cancer. Coach Hobbs can be seen with his wife Joann
and GW Assistant Coaches Darrell Brooks and Roland Houston in public service announcements
that urge men to get tested. These announcements will be aired on WUSA 9, a partner of the GW
Cancer Institute, throughout September.
